Abstract. The purpose of the article is to present memories of Borys Voznytsky, Hero of Ukraine, Laureate of the Taras Shevchenko State Prize, Honored Worker of Culture of Ukraine and Poland, who had Presidential Awards, Orders of Merit, was an Honorary Citizen of five cities, Honorary Doctor of Sciences, Academician.

Corresponding Member of the Academy of Arts of Ukraine (2006). Awarded the Gold Medal of the Academy of Arts of Ukraine (2006).

These were not just awards and distinctions — this is a small part of what the Motherland could thank for that titanically devoted, selfless work of Borys Voznytsky and his team. The work to save and revive tens of thousands of works of national art, monuments of architecture. Covering issues of such topics is an integral part of research into the folk culture of Ukrainians.

The territorial boundaries of the material are logically determined by the starting points of Borys Voznytskyi’s activities  — Lviv and the entire Lviv region.

The author of the article is a long-time employee of the Lviv Art Gallery, based on numerous interviews with Borys Voznytskyi and own observations during many years of cooperation with Borys Hryhorovych, she published several scientific publications dedicated to the history of the museum and the figure of Voznytskyi.

The relevance of the topic is due to the 100th anniversary of the birth of Borys Voznytskyi.

The methodological basis of the study was the methods of field ethnographic research, in particular interviewing the respondent, biographical and analytical methods, with a combination of historical reconstruction.

Boikos’ pandemonium: categories of evil deceased
In the article have been presented some research-work on peculiarities of Boikos’ traditional demonological notions as for so-called evil deceased; on the basis of field records and ethnological literary sources quite a number of scum categories have been defined as well as essential habits, modes of behavior and functions of these personages of people’s demonology.

Wax candle as ukrainian Christmas and epiphany ritualistic text
For the first time in native ethnology the article has brought some results of special study in sign functionality of a wax candle under the context of Ukrainian Christmas and Epiphany ritualistic text (ritualism of Christmas Eve, New Year, Epiphany Eve and Feast of Epiphany). The study has stated extremely high semiotic position of a wax candle as projection of Sun, mediator between the spheres of sacral and prophane elements, symbolic analogue of human existence, apotropy, cultural symbol re-establishing borders of acculturated space.

Traditional folk clothes of velikobychkovsky hutsuly of XIX — the first half of XX century
In the study based upon numerous field materials, literature sources as well as ethnographic, historio-cultural and regional museum collections has been performed complex analysis in traditional folk clothes by Hutzul population of Velyky Bychkiv village in Transcarpathian region. Detailed descriptions of femi­nine and masculine clothing complexes of the mentioned area have been presented. In characterizing of those main attention has been paid to the detail of cut in separate components of dress; cut of feminine shirt has been added as an illustration.

On field exploration of russian and belarusian ethnologists and etnolinguists in Ukrainian Polisia 1945—1980s
In the study based on a wide range of literary materials have been comprehensively characterised field research in Polisia of Ukraine, performed by Russian and Belarusian ethnologists during 1945—1980s as well as Moscow ethnolinguists and other researchers from ethnologic centres of Russia, Ukraine and Belarus in the course of realization of Ethnolinguistic Atlas of Polisia program. Particular attention has been paid to geography, methods, themes and research results of scientific projects.
